当然可以了,但是要下一个mysql的驱动
Class.forName("org.gjt.mm.mysql.Driver").newInstance(); 
conn = java.sql.DriverManager.getConnection("jdbc:mysql://localhost/数据库名","root","");

解决方案 »

  1.   

    可以阿,呵呵:
    public int connectdb(String s)throws Exception
    {
    String CLASSFORNAME="com.mysql.jdbc.Driver";
    String DBURL="jdbc:mysql://localhost/database?user=t&password=t";
             Connection conn = null;
    int flag = 1;
    try { 
             Class.forName(CLASSFORNAME).newInstance(); 
    if(!(s.equals("")))
        DBURL = s;
    conn =  DriverManager.getConnection(DBURL);
            }
    catch (Exception ex)
    {
    flag = -1;
    System.out.println("load driver error!" + ex.getMessage());
    conn.close();
    throw ex;
    } return flag;
    }
    //即你连接的是本地的mysql服务器,其中数据库名为database,user为t,password为t.
    在连接执行之前请设置你的环境变量,保证jdbc已经配置。
      

  2.   

    哦,谢谢二位了,在下初次接触MySQL,还望各位多多帮助。再次感谢!!!